What 24/7 Network Monitoring Actually Watches

Good monitoring is not just “is it online?” It tracks performance, trends, and risk signals. Therefore, it can prevent failures that look random to end users.

Core monitoring signals in UniFi environments

  • Device uptime: gateways, switches, access points, controllers
  • ISP status: packet loss, latency spikes, outages, failover events
  • AP health: client counts, retries, channel utilization, roaming behavior
  • Switch health: port errors, link negotiation issues, PoE load
  • Security signals: rogue devices, unusual traffic, policy violations
  • Capacity trends: growth in devices and peak-hour congestion

In addition, monitoring builds a baseline. Consequently, you can spot “drift” before it becomes a crisis.

7 Problems 24/7 Monitoring Prevents (Real-World Examples)

Monitoring prevents problems by catching early warning signs. Therefore, let’s break down what it actually stops in real environments.

1) ISP issues before they become “the WiFi is broken”

Many “WiFi outages” are actually ISP issues. Monitoring catches packet loss and latency spikes early. As a result, you can open a carrier ticket faster or trigger failover if you have a secondary connection.

2) PoE failures that silently take down access points

PoE problems can look random. A port may flap, a switch may overload, or a cable may degrade. Monitoring catches PoE load changes and port errors. Therefore, you fix the cause before APs start dropping.

3) Capacity creep (the slow decline that ends in peak-hour pain)

Device counts grow over time. Guest usage grows. Video meetings increase. Consequently, networks that were fine last year become slow this year. Monitoring tracks trends so you can plan upgrades before users complain.

4) RF congestion and interference spikes

Neighbor networks change. Tenants move in. New devices appear. Therefore, RF conditions shift. Monitoring can highlight rising retries, channel utilization, and roaming failures so you can tune channels and power.

5) Firmware risk (bad timing causes downtime)

Firmware updates are necessary. However, unplanned updates can cause outages. Managed UniFi services include firmware management, testing strategy, and safe scheduling. As a result, you avoid “we updated and now it’s broken.”

6) Misconfigurations that break guest WiFi or segmentation

Small changes can have big effects. For example, a VLAN mapping mistake can break POS or guest WiFi. Monitoring and proactive support catch these issues quickly. Therefore, downtime stays short.

7) Early hardware failure signs

Hardware often shows warning signs before it fails. Port errors, reboots, temperature events, and unstable links are clues. Consequently, proactive replacement prevents a surprise outage.

Proactive Support: What It Includes (Beyond Monitoring)

Monitoring tells you what is happening. Proactive support is what you do about it. Therefore, managed UniFi services include ongoing maintenance and improvement, not just alerts.

Common proactive support activities

  • Firmware planning and safe update windows
  • Performance baselines and monthly health reviews
  • Channel plan tuning as RF conditions change
  • Capacity planning recommendations before peak-hour slowdowns
  • Security policy checks and segmentation validation
  • Documentation updates after changes
  • Incident response playbooks for outages

As a result, the network improves over time instead of degrading.

What to Ask Before You Buy Managed UniFi Services

Not all managed services are equal. Therefore, ask these questions before you commit:

  • What is monitored (ISP, switches, APs, PoE, performance trends)?
  • How fast is response during nights and weekends?
  • Is firmware management included, and how are updates tested?
  • Do you get health reports and performance baselines?
  • Is there a clear escalation path for outages?
  • Will the provider help with capacity planning and design improvements?

As a result, you choose a service that prevents problems, not one that just emails alerts.
